ZY Yao
ZY Yao
Adult spot-legged treefrog
Polypedates megacephalus Hallowell, 1861.
Close to the Motuo town, south of Tibet.
333
views
1
fave
0
comments
Uploaded on October 22, 2016
Taken on August 7, 2016
Adult spot-legged treefrog
Polypedates megacephalus Hallowell, 1861.
Close to the Motuo town, south of Tibet.
333
views
1
fave
0
comments
Uploaded on October 22, 2016
Taken on August 7, 2016